Overview
Plot:
Treasure hunter Benjamin Franklin Gates looks to discover the truth behind the assassination of Abraham Lincoln, by uncovering the mystery within the 18 pages missing from assassin John Wilkes Booth's diary. full summary | full synopsis (warning! may contain spoilers)Plot Keywords:

Goofs:
Errors made by characters (possibly deliberate errors by the filmmakers): While being chased through London, Ben asks Abigail if her phone has a camera so that he can take a picture of the wooden plank found in the resolute desk. She says that her phone's camera is broken and hence they have to use the traffic camera to get a picture of the plank. Riley fails to notice/mention however that his MacBook has a camera right in the top bezel. moreSoundtrack:

Can someone please explain to me how Nicolas Cage convinces filmmakers that he's credible as an action hero? While the first instalment was kinda fun, this plot-hole-ridden golf cart ride is as forgettable as who you sat next to in the second grade.
Some light-hearted moments pepper the duration, and Diane Krueger certainly is easy to watch. But all in all, this looks like a hormone-fed franchise just waiting to milked.
The swiss-cheese plot is about a race against bad guys to clear the name of one of Ben Gates' (Cage) forefathers (although "one of his four fathers" might have made for a more interesting premise). This after the revelation that they may have been complicit in the killing of...wait for it...Abraham Lincoln.
I'm convinced the writers realised that no-one would care about this, but being too lazy to start again (either that or too pre-occupied making writers strike picket placards), shifted the plot implausibly to a treasure hunt for a lost city of gold. And then threw in something about a conspiracy involving presidents just for good measure.
A hop to Paris, a skip to London and a jump back to the US later, one wonders if the plot devices aren't completely lost on US Americans who have no concept of maps (Geography)..and historical facts... and such as like.
